Former UFC heavyweight title challenger Gabriel “Napao” Gonzaga Victorious in pro boxing debut
“NEW ENGLAND’S FUTURE 4” REZULTATAI
Gabrielis Gonzaga (R) won his pro boxing debut
WORCESTER, Mišios. (Spalis 29, 2017) – Former UFC heavyweight title challenger Gabrielius “Napao” Gonzaga has a successful pro boxing debut last night (Šeštadienis, Spalis. 28) in the co-featured event on the “New England’s Future 4” korta, pateikė Rivera Akcijos Pramogos (RPE), at DCU Center, Exhibition Hall, Worcester.
6′ 2″, 280-pound Brazilian, now fighting out of Worcester (MA), fought another pro-debut boxer with limited MMA experience, Alejandro Esquilin Santiago, Tampa (FL). Gonzaga stalked the southpaw Santiago, landing some hard shots in the opening round. The heavy-handed Gonzaga picked up the pace in the third and his upset-minded opponent responded in a positive fashion. Both fighters exchanged freely in the fourth and final round, neither was hurt during the contest, and Gonzaga was awarded a win by four-round majority decision.
“I thought I’d be more relaxed in the ring like I had been in the gym,” Gonzaga said. “I did my best and came away with a victory. I was too safe in the third round. My punches were much strong and a lot of his punches I blocked with my gloves. This was really great! šįvakar”
Gonzaga (L) defeated Santiago
“I felt good and gave it my all,” Santiago remarked. “He hit me with some shots and gave ’em back. Not only does he have a big nose (“Napao”), he has a strong, big head, per daug.”
Į pagrindinį renginį, popular Hartford (KT) šviesos sunkiasvoris Richardas “Popeye jūrininkas Vyras” Rivera liko nenugalėtas, improving his record to 4-0 (3 Kos), with a first-round knockout of an over-matched Hansen Castillo (0-3)
Rivera, not relations to the promoter, first dropped Castillo with a beautifully placed left uppercut and finished the show moments later with a left hook that sent Castillo flying to canvas. Teisėjas Kevin Hope didn’t bother to count.
“My coaches were telling me to be calm because it was a six-round bout,” rivera paaiškino. “I saw that he had his left down and caught him with an uppercut. I’m strong to the finish because I eat my spinach.”
New Haven junior middleweight Edwin Sosa (11-2-2, 4 Kos) overcame at 15-pound disadvantage, bent jau, en route to a dominant six-round unanimous decision over Anthony “The Animal” Everett (1-7), of Rowley (MA).
Danbury (KT) Junior Papildsvars Omaras Borojus, Jaunesnysis. (3-0, 1 KO) stopped New York veteran Bryan “The Brick” Abraomas (6-31, 6 Kos) in the fourth and final round. Abraham was decked twice and after counting to 10 after Abraham’s second time on the canvas, teisėjas Paul Casey waved off the action.
Three-time national amateur champion Elvis “Chi Chi” Figueroa (3-0, 1 KO), fighting out of New Haven, pitched a complete shutout over a game, Pro-debiutujących Rene Nazare(0-1), Brazilijos, for a convincing win by way of a four-round unanimous decision.
Southbridge (MA) Papildsvars Wilfredo “Sucaro” pagonis (3-0, 1 KO) pinnedPatrickas Lealas (0-4), iš Woburn, on the ropes early, dropping him three times until referee Casey halted the fight midway through the opening round.

Former national amateur champion Bobby Harris III breaking out of shadow cast by his father with a little help from his friends
Spalis 28 Worcester, MA
|
(L-R) – front: Bobby Harris III holding Bobby Harris IV and A.J. Rivera; rear: Bobby Harris and Jose Antonio Rivera
WORCESTER, Mišios. (Spalis 2, 2017) – Vietos perspektyva Policininkas “BH3” Harris III is ready to breakout of the shadows cast by his father, retired pro boxer Bobis Harrisas, pradedant Šeštadienis naktis, Spalis 28, in the fourth and final 2017 installment of the popular professional boxing series, “Naujosios Anglijos ateitis”, tuo DCU Center (Exhibition Hall) Worcester, Masačusetsas.
“New England’s Future 4” is presented by Rivera Promotions Entertainment (RPE), which is owned and operated by retired three-time, du skyrius pasaulio čempionas Jose Antonio Rivera ir jo sūnus, Anthonee (A.J.) Rivera.
“BH3” and A.J. grew-up together in gyms as sons of pro fighters. They had dreams of making it in boxing, which has come to fruition with “BH3” auga perspektyva, A.J. the president and matchmaker for RPE. Kartais, nors, what’s transpired may be somewhat surreal for both young men.
“I grew up in boxing,” Bobby Harris III explained. “My father always brought me to the gym and his fights. My uncle, Adam Harris, was also a pro boxer. My father and Jose were super close, me and A.J. grew-up as brothers. The same blood couldn’t make us any closer. It’s me and AJ. My first amateur fight was when I was 13. A.J. used to run and workout with me. I’d go to his house after school and sleep over on weekends. We planned our lives together in boxing; my job is to fight and A.J. promotes and makes matches.”
“I remember growing up with Bobby as my brother,” A.J. pridėta. “We did everything together: ran, trained, sparred and pushed each other to our greatest limits. He’s grown so much over the years. His natural ability, mixed with years of experience, and Bobby growing into a man will surely lead to him being world champion one day. I’m truly proud and excited to see our childhood plan unfold.”
“BH3” only had about 40 amateur matches but the large majority were at the national level. He is a two-time national amateur champion, including a gold-medal performance in the USA National Championships, and as a member of Team USA, he was rated No. 1 į Ne JAV, ir Nr. 2 pasaulyje.
The 21-year-old decided to turn pro earlier this year, rather than wait for a shot at the Olympics, after discussing his options with his father, as well as Jose and A.J. Rivera, plus his head trainer, Rocky Gonzalez. Worcester boxers such as Jermaine Ortiz ir Irvin Gonzalez turning pro, along with the arrival of now 8-month-old Bobby Harris IV, were key factors in his decision to become a professional boxer. “I didn’t want to waste another year,” Bobby admitted. “Turning pro now will get me into rankings earlier. The time was right”
Bobby’s father was a 4-time national amateur champion as a super heavyweight who compiled a 20-2-1 (13 Kos) pro record between 1993 ir 1999. Šiandien, he is an important member of his son’s corner, but he did leave a shadow cast over his son, especially across New England.
“People will always compare me with my dad, žiedas, bet, as good as he was, it’s a great honor to be his son,” Bobby Harris III remarked. “It’s been nothing but good for me. He trained with fighters like (Oskaras) De La Hoya, (Shane) Mosley, (Evanderis) Holyfieldas and so many other great fighters. We are different, nors. and now I’m establishing my own identity. The sport has changed so much since he fought. Back then it was mostly two guys beating each other up, not as much of a performance. I like to put on a good performance and have people say, ‘He’s cool, and when does he fight again. My dad has told me how different boxing is today compared to when he fought. Dabar, marketing is so important for fighters, and a lot of exposure is through social media.
“My father was a heavyweight, I’m going to go down to 154 (Junior vidutinio svorio. He is so much bigger, taller and heavier than I am, so fighting in different weight classes separates us. I’m a different style fighter, taip pat. I’m more active than him. So that people don’t confuse us when talking, I came up with ‘BH3’ as my persona. We are different in and out of the ring.”
“I have known Little Bobby (as I call him) since he was born,” Jose Rivera noted. “He calls me, Tio (uncle) Chosė, and I love him like a member of my family. I am happy and proud to see little Bobby go after his dreams and goals his way and on his terms. I wouldn’t want it any other way. My son, A.J., and I are happy that we can use our RPE company to be able to help little Bobby pursue his dreams and goals. Vusteris – and soon enough the rest of the world – will know it’s BH3 Time!”
“BH3” turned pro this past Birželis 10, in his Worcester hometown, taking a four-round unanimous decision (40-36 X 3) over an awkward opponent, Rodrigo Almeida, who seemed more interested in survival, often frustrating “BH3” with his constant holding.
“I’m happy with the way that fight went because I learned so much,” Bobby commented. “I was so excited with all the hype about my pro debut, and I was into the crowd trying for the knockout. I learned that I need to take my time, have fun, throw combinations and that the knockout will come. Dad liked to jab, I like to hit and run like ‘Cukrus’ Spindulys (Leonardas). My first pro fight wasn’t really me. I’m the matador but I can fight like a bull if the opportunity comes to me. I can change things around but I forgot to have fun in my pro debut.”
“BH3” plans to breakout from his father’s shadow in his Oct. 28oji fight against New Yorker Troy Omer “KO Artist” menininkas (3-7-1, 2 Kos), contested at a 164-pound catchweight, in a four-round bout.
